The Unilever Future Leaders Programme – Sales (Customer Development)

Our Sales (Customer Development) UFLP designed to grow future commercial leaders. You’ll gain hands-on experience across sales, category management, e-commerce, and customer strategy, working with top retailers and real-time market data. With personalised development, mentorship, and exposure to global best practices, this program equips you to drive growth and deliver purpose-led business results.

Recruitment process:

Online Application → Online Assessment → Digital Interview → Discovery Centre → Onboarding

Applications close: 5 September 2025, Midnight AEST
Discovery Centre: Mid-October 2025

Program start: January 2026
